Abstract Run-of-mine (ROM) coal
was separated by gravitational techniques into fractions designated as 1.30 float
(clean coal) and 2.00 sink (pyrite and ash). Dielectric properties were
measured and used to predict heating rates. Predicted values suggested that
pyrite and ash would heat 1.3 to 3.3 times faster than clean coal. Dielectric
heating was investigated by heating mixtures containing these two fractions
at 2.45 GHz. Results indicated that the pyrite and ash fraction was heated
from 1.9 to 2.6 times faster than clean coal. |
